MGA6-32-OK shotwell functions worked on a Kodak RAW image and displayed it in natural colour. With nomacs it came up as a greenscale image which could be changed to greyscale. shotwell detected 6 ORF images inside the RAW file so it looked like nomacs simply picked the first one. Image manipulations worked in nomacs. Used nomacs to view various raw formats from Canon, Kodak, Nikon and Olympus cameras, 35 images in total. They all displayed properly. Tried out some of the libraw tools. $ 4channels R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F Processing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F Black level (unscaled)=0 Writing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.R.tiff Writing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.G.tiff Writing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.B.tiff Writing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.G2.tiff The TIFF files could not be displayed using nomacs or shotwell. Not obvious from the help that this would happen. The '-s N' option failed for all values of N. $ 4channels -s 2 R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F Processing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F Cannot unpack R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F: Request for nonexisting image number This looks like a change of functionality rather than a regression. $ multirender_test R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F Processing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F Writing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.1.ppm Writing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.2.ppm Writing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.3.ppm Writing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.4.ppm Writing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.5.ppm Writing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.6.ppm Writing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.7.ppm Writing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.8.ppm All the ppm files could be displayed using ImageMagick and the 'next' option. $ display *.ppm Each was a manipulated version of the original image. $ postprocessing_benchmark -R 20 R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F Processing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F 15.7 msec for unpack Performance: 9.37 Mpix/sec File: R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F, Frame: 0 2.7 total Mpix, 284.4 msec Params: WB=default Highlight=0 Qual=-1 HalfSize=No Median=0 Wavelet=0 Crop: 0-0:2012x1324, active Mpix: 2.66, 3.5 frames/sec $ raw-identify RAW_FUJI* RAW_FUJI_S5PRO_V106.RAF is a Fujifilm S5Pro image. RAW_FUJI_S6500FD.RAF is a Fujifilm S6500fd image. RAW_FUJI_X-T10.RAF is a Fujifilm X-T10 image. $ unprocessed_raw R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F Processing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F Image size: 2012x1324 Raw size: 2012x1324 Margins: top=0, left=0 Unpacked.... Stored to file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.pgm Without gamma correction the resulting file was mostly black with a very faint hint of the actual scene. $ unprocessed_raw -g R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F Processing file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F Image size: 2012x1324 Raw size: 2012x1324 Margins: top=0, left=0 Unpacked.... Gamma-corrected.... Stored to file RAW_NIKON_D1.NEF.pgm This applied a gamma correction of 2.2, which revealed a greyscale image. The package works leaving aside the lack of proper documentation for some of the libraw tools. Whiteboard:
